Transaction 415596ba638fb87f859fccfa268afd549d7e94b5f8524a2c0155c2dc5977e939
1 Input
-
7cf5b720af2b1b1e07d2581ec3c283dc087ebef71dc4a3994105ca35c256a0d9:6
OP_DATA_48(48) 44022075f23fa81394357a3c9ce0181e731ef9407c5b42b6345954a943fe8bcf84917f02205483d97b33747dae6cb5d1
1 Outputs
- 415596ba638fb87f859fccfa268afd549d7e94b5f8524a2c0155c2dc5977e939:0
value 445518
address 3D4eAfAAkeyHRRsvUcfKfGNqwuQmobyzuQ